Phages and their potential to modulate the microbiome and immunity

Bacteriophages (phages) are viruses that infect bacteria and show promise for treating antibiotic-resistant infections. Understanding phage-bacteria-host interactions is key to developing new phage-based therapies for microbiome modulation and disease treatment.
Area of Science:
- Microbiology
- Virology
- Immunology
Background:
- Bacteriophages (phages) are viruses targeting bacteria, with potential for treating antibiotic-resistant infections.
- Decades of research have limited understanding of phage-bacteria-host molecular interactions, hindering therapeutic applications.
- Next-generation sequencing advances are revealing novel phage lytic and lysogenic mechanisms.
Purpose of the Study:
- To review recent advances in phage biology and phage-bacteria-host interactions.
- To explore the potential of phages as targeted modulators of the human microbiome.
- To discuss challenges and solutions for developing phage-based therapeutics.
Main Methods:
- Review of current literature on phage biology and therapeutic applications.
- Analysis of next-generation sequencing data for understanding phage mechanisms.
- Discussion of phage-bacteria-host interaction studies.
Main Results:
- Phages offer a vast antibacterial repertoire and ease of manipulation for targeted microbiome modulation.
- Mechanistic understanding of phage-bacteria-host interactions is advancing rapidly.
- Phages can potentially impact mammalian physiology and immunity, especially at mucosal surfaces.
Conclusions:
- Phage-based therapeutics hold significant promise for treating infectious and noncommunicable diseases.
- Further research into phage biology and interactions is crucial for realizing their therapeutic potential.
- Phages can be developed as specific modulators of the human microbiome for health and disease management.
